Narasimha Satakam
Encyclopedia
Narasimha Satakam is a compilation of 100 poems by Seshappa
.
They are primary based on devotion and morality and set in simple language.

Seshappa
Seshappa is a Telugu poet who wrote Narasimha Satakam. He probably lived in the early 19th century. He belongs to Dharmapuri under Nizam's region.His poetry is simple and strongly devotional.-External links:*...
